You should have received a copy of the GNU General Public License along with this program; if not, write to the Free Software Foundation, Inc., 675 Mass Ave, Cambridge, MA 02139, USA. */ #ifndef _RPC_EVENTLOG_H #define _RPC_EVENTLOG_H #define EVENTLOG_OPEN 0x07 #define EVENTLOG_CLOSE 0x02 #define EVENTLOG_NUMOFEVENTLOGRECORDS 0x04 #define EVENTLOG_READEVENTLOG 0x0a #define EVENTLOG_READ_SEQUENTIAL 0x01 #define EVENTLOG_READ_SEEK 0x02 #define EVENTLOG_READ_FORWARD 0x04 #define EVENTLOG_READ_BACKWARD 0x08 #define EVENTLOG_OK 0X00 #define EVENTLOG_ERROR 0x01 #define EVENTLOG_WARNING 0x02 #define EVENTLOG_INFORMATION 0x04 #define EVENTLOG_AUDIT_OK 0x08 #define EVENTLOG_AUDIT_ERROR 0x10 typedef struct eventlogrecord { uint32 size; uint32 reserved; uint32 recordnumber; uint32 creationtime; uint32 writetime; uint32 eventnumber; uint16 eventtype; uint16 num_of_strings; uint16 category; uint16 reserved_flag; uint32 closingrecord; uint32 stringoffset; uint32 sid_length; uint32 sid_offset; uint32 data_length; uint32 data_offset; UNISTR sourcename; UNISTR computername; UNISTR sid; UNISTR strings; UNISTR data; uint32 size2; } EVENTLOGRECORD; typedef struct eventlog_q_open { uint32 ptr0; uint16 unk0; uint16 unk1; UNIHDR hdr_source; UNISTR2 uni_source; UNIHDR hdr_unk; UNISTR2 uni_unk; uint32 unk6; uint32 unk7; } EVENTLOG_Q_OPEN; typedef struct eventlog_r_open { POLICY_HND pol; uint32 status; } EVENTLOG_R_OPEN; typedef struct eventlog_q_close { POLICY_HND pol; } EVENTLOG_Q_CLOSE; typedef struct eventlog_r_close { POLICY_HND pol; uint32 status; } EVENTLOG_R_CLOSE; typedef struct eventlog_q_numofeventlogrec { POLICY_HND pol; } EVENTLOG_Q_NUMOFEVENTLOGREC; typedef struct eventlog_r_numofeventlogrec { uint32 number; uint32 status; } EVENTLOG_R_NUMOFEVENTLOGREC; typedef struct eventlog_q_readeventlog { POLICY_HND pol; uint32 flags; uint32 offset; uint32 number_of_bytes; } EVENTLOG_Q_READEVENTLOG; typedef struct eventlog_r_readeventlog { uint32 number_of_bytes; EVENTLOGRECORD *event; uint32 sent_size; uint32 real_size; uint32 status; } EVENTLOG_R_READEVENTLOG; #endif /* _RPC_EVENTLOG_H */
